I posted this earlier in a different thread.

I am going to start a low cal, low carb diet, that uses the Dry Meal rule. it gets you started for how you will eat from surgery on. 3 meals a day 700-800 cal 40-50 carbs 60-70 protein.

breakfast

1 protein (pref a protein shake 20-30 grams)

1 fruit

1 dairy

lunch

1 protein (pref another shake)

2 vegetables

dinner

1 protein

2 vegetables

Only proteins allowed:- protein shake or 3/4 C low fat cottage cheese or 2 whole eggs or 3 oz cooked meat (skinned, fat removed, not breaded not fried, no processed meats like bacon, ham, lunch meats, hot dogs etc) this protein is only when you really feel you need something more. red meats are longer to digest, chicken & seafood is better.

Only dairy allowed 8oz 1% or skim milk 6-8oz light yogurt (no more than 20grams of carbs) 1 part-skim string cheese

fruit & veg's best is fresh follow the serving size on them. no potatoes, no corn, no peas, or any other starch veg's can use frozen, the just recommend rinsing them. if you have to use canned drain & rinse.

if & only if you need a snack, use a shake. make sure to count the calories

& most of all that they stress a GOOD Multivitamin that has 100% of the RDA, Calcium 1200 mg w/ Vitamin D at least 400 IU make sure they are all chewable, gummy or liquid.

*this diet isn't that bad. they say that its expected to be 12-20 lbs weight-loss in 2 weeks.

Those of you who are on the 2 week liquid diet' date=' can you please share what you will be doing? I haven't had much direction on that from my Dr. He just said to loose 5 lbs...[/quote']

My dr. Is very strict ... I start my 2 week liquid diet 8-28

Clear liquids only

Sugar free jello, Popsicle, koolaid,

Power aid Zero

Sugarfree coffee, or tea

Strained chicken or beef broth

And 2-3 advant edge protien shakes

At least 8-12 glasses of water a day
